Multiply 21/96 with 3/63

This multiplication involving fractions can also be rephrased as "What is 21/96 of 3/63?"

21/96 × 3/63 is 1/96.

Steps for multiplying fractions

  1. Simply multiply the numerators and denominators separately:
  2. 21/96 × 3/63 = 21 × 3/96 × 63 = 63/6048
  3. After reducing the fraction, the answer is 1/96
